Training Course
24-27 April 2025 | Lago di Bolsena , Italy
An immersive four-day experiential journey around Lake Bolsena, designed to challenge, inspire, and transform by Kamaleonte
From 12:30 PM on April 24th to 12:30 PM on April 27th, 2025, participants will embark on a trekking adventure that combines physical exploration, personal development, and experiential learning. This training course is a follow-up event of several Erasmus+ projects carried out in recent years, including Refl'Action, iMotion, and ExitBurnout. It serves as a dissemination event to share the practices and results of these projects.
This initiative is part of the broader vision of the International Academy of Experiential Education (viaexperientia.net), aiming to expand the Italian and European experiential education network. It is not a commercial initiative but a unique opportunity to foster collaboration and connection among like-minded professionals youth-workers and educators.
The experience does not end after the four-day journey: participants will have access to a coaching period and practical application support through the Academy’s network, which includes more than 48 partners across European countries.
This program is entirely technology-free—no mobile phones, no digital distractions—allowing participants to be fully present in the moment. With no guaranteed meals, accommodations, or use of money, the adventure fosters creativity, collaboration, and resilience as participants rely on their resourcefulness and the hospitality of local communities.
The journey becomes a shared story, co-created through collective problem-solving, decision-making, and mutual support.
This experience is carefully designed to promote personal growth, relational skills, and professional development, particularly in youth work and experiential education.

The organizers of this unique program are Kamaleonte, a distinguished organization with extensive expertise in experiential learning, outdoor education, and personal development. Kamaleonte’s approach is rooted in creating transformative experiences that combine connection with nature, innovative methodologies, and a strong focus on human relationships.
Our framework of activity is designed to empower individuals and groups by facilitating opportunities for self-discovery, resilience building, and skill development. At Kamaleonte, we believe in the power of experiential education to spark meaningful growth—not through lectures or traditional instruction, but through immersion, active participation, and real-life challenges.
Our facilitators and trainers are members of various international pools of trainers within the framework of TCA (Transnational Cooperation Activities) programs, collaborating with national agencies under Erasmus+: Youth in Action. With over 20 years of experience in designing and delivering these types of programs, they bring unparalleled expertise, a wealth of practical tools, and a deep understanding of experiential methodologies to create impactful learning opportunities for participants.
